Tanakurahiko Shrine
棚倉孫神社
Tanakurahiko Shrine is a historic shrine with a beautiful main hall, easily accessible from two stations.
What it is
- A historic shrine in Kyotanabe City, Kyoto Prefecture.
- Ranked as a grand shrine in the Engishiki Jinmyocho.
- Called Tenmangu during the Edo period.
- Promoted to Jugoinojo on January 27, 859.
What to see
- The main hall, a Kyoto Prefecture Registered Tangible Cultural Property.
- The main hall was built during the Momoyama period.
- The Zuiki Mikoshi, a Kyotanabe City Intangible Cultural Property.
